Tropical plants have a ___ temperature optimum than the plants adapted to temperate climates.

A

lower

B

equal

C

higher

D

None of these

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

The correct Answer is:
**Step-by-Step Solution:** 1. **Understanding the Question:** The question asks us to compare the temperature optimum of tropical plants with that of plants adapted to temperate climates. 2. **Identifying Tropical Plants:** Tropical plants are those that thrive in tropical regions, which are characterized by high temperatures and humidity. These plants are adapted to these warm conditions. 3. **Identifying Temperate Plants:** In contrast, temperate plants are found in temperate climates, which have moderate to low temperatures. These plants are adapted to cooler conditions compared to tropical plants. 4. **Temperature Optimum:** The term "temperature optimum" refers to the ideal temperature range at which a plant can perform photosynthesis most efficiently. 5. **C4 and C3 Plants:** - Tropical plants, which are often C4 plants, are adapted to higher temperatures and show an increased rate of photosynthesis at these temperatures. - Temperate plants, which are typically C3 plants, perform best at lower temperatures. 6. **Conclusion:** Since tropical plants are adapted to higher temperatures, we conclude that tropical plants have a **higher** temperature optimum than plants adapted to temperate climates. **Final Answer:** Tropical plants have a **higher** temperature optimum than the plants adapted to temperate climates. ---
